THIS is the first season Okehampton Argyle has had an Under 18 team and with all the  squad U17 the club are hoping for a better season next season. 

In the final game Argyle hosted Alphington, a side much older containing some county players. The  first ten minutes was a disaster for Argyle and they found themselves 0-2 down. Argyle then settled down and went in half time with hope in the second half.

The second half started much as the first, with Alphington in control  and added to their tally to make it 0-3   Then Argyle started to battle and pulled a goal back from George Walsh. They went on to create more chances but Alphington ended up 3-1 winners.

Argyle manager Phil Squires said: ‘We are fortunate to have completed our matches this season due to the weather and this would not be viable  if we did not have help from staff at Ashbury Manor  by loaning us their 3G pitch which we would like to thank them.
